Key Insights
The North America membrane water treatment chemicals market is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ing demand for clean water across various sectors. The market, estimated at $XX million in 2025, is projected to exhibit a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) exceeding 6% from 2025 to 2033. This expansion is fueled by several key factors. Stringent environmental regulations concerning water discharge are compelling industries like food and beverage processing, healthcare, and power generation to adopt advanced water treatment technologies, significantly boosting the demand for membrane treatment chemicals. Furthermore, the rising prevalence of water scarcity and the need for efficient water reuse initiatives are contributing to market growth. The pre-treatment chemicals segment holds a significant market share, reflecting the crucial role of effective pre-treatment in optimizing membrane performance and extending their lifespan. Major players like Ecolab, Kurita, and Kemira are leveraging their technological expertise and extensive distribution networks to capitalize on the market's growth potential. Competition is intense, with companies focusing on innovation to develop environmentally friendly and cost-effective solutions. While the market faces some restraints, such as fluctuating raw material prices and potential regulatory changes, the overall outlook remains positive, suggesting significant opportunities for growth in the forecast period.
The North American market is segmented by chemical type (pre-treatment, biological controllers, other chemical types) and end-user industry (food & beverage processing, healthcare, municipal, chemicals, power, other end-user industries). The food and beverage processing industry is a major driver, as stringent hygiene and quality standards necessitate efficient water treatment. The healthcare sector's need for sterile water further fuels demand. Within the chemical types, pre-treatment chemicals are expected to maintain a leading position due to their essential role in optimizing membrane performance. The United States, Canada, and Mexico represent the key regional markets within North America, each exhibiting unique growth patterns based on factors such as regulatory frameworks, industrial activity, and water resource availability. The continued focus on sustainable water management practices and technological advancements will likely shape the market trajectory in the coming years.

North America Membrane Water Treatment Chemicals Market Concentration & Innovation
The North American membrane water treatment chemicals market exhibits a moderately concentrated landscape, with a few major players holding significant market share. Ecolab, Dow, and Kemira, for example, collectively account for an estimated xx% of the market in 2025. However, the market also features several smaller, specialized companies focusing on niche applications. Market concentration is influenced by factors such as economies of scale, technological capabilities, and brand recognition. Innovation is a key driver, with companies investing heavily in R&D to develop novel chemistries addressing stricter regulatory requirements and the growing demand for sustainable water treatment solutions. The market is witnessing substantial M&A activity, with deal values exceeding xx Million in the last five years. These activities, often focused on expanding product portfolios and geographic reach, further shape market dynamics. Regulatory frameworks, such as the EPA's regulations on discharge limits and water quality standards, are significant influences, pushing innovation towards more environmentally friendly and effective solutions. The increasing prevalence of membrane fouling necessitates continuous innovation in anti-scalants and cleaning agents. Moreover, end-user preferences are shifting towards environmentally conscious solutions, driving growth in bio-based and biodegradable chemicals.

Dominant Markets & Segments in North America Membrane Water Treatment Chemicals Market
The municipal segment holds the largest market share within the end-user industry, driven by increasing investments in water infrastructure and the need to meet stringent water quality standards. Within chemical types, pre-treatment chemicals dominate due to their crucial role in preventing membrane fouling and extending the lifespan of membrane systems. The US dominates the North American market, followed by Canada and Mexico.
Key Drivers for Dominant Segments:
- Municipal: Increasing investments in water infrastructure, stringent water quality regulations, growing urbanization.
- Pre-treatment Chemicals: Crucial for membrane protection, enhanced system efficiency, and cost savings.
- US Dominance: Large population, established water infrastructure, significant investments in water treatment technologies.
Detailed Dominance Analysis: The municipal segment's dominance is directly linked to substantial government funding for infrastructure upgrades and water treatment plant modernization. The pre-treatment segment's leading position stems from its crucial role in protecting expensive membrane systems. The US market's significant size reflects the country's robust economy, substantial population, and significant investments in water treatment.

Challenges in the North America Membrane Water Treatment Chemicals Market Sector
Several challenges hinder market growth. Fluctuating raw material prices increase production costs. Stringent regulatory approvals for new chemicals can delay product launches. Intense competition and pressure on pricing margins are significant issues. Supply chain disruptions can affect production and distribution.
Emerging Opportunities in North America Membrane Water Treatment Chemicals Market
Several opportunities are emerging. The growing demand for sustainable and eco-friendly water treatment solutions is creating space for bio-based and biodegradable chemicals. Advanced oxidation processes (AOPs) offer potential for treating challenging contaminants. The increasing adoption of membrane filtration in emerging applications presents new market avenues.
